Key Responsibilities
- Work in an oligonucleotide therapeutic drug discovery research lab and interface across different therapeutic areas, including neuroscience, immunology and oncology, to help build a comprehensive therapeutic discovery strategy.
- Show good understanding and troubleshooting experience in oligonucleotide synthesis, impurity profiling is a plus.
- Collaborate with other scientists to maintain common lab equipment such as oligo synthesizers, HPLC and desalting units.
- Perform literature reviews, propose, and execute nucleic acid chemistry plans, coordinate chemistry and biology data to support oligonucleotide compound progression.
- Establish methods for scaled-up synthesis of lead molecules and coordinate material delivery for preclinical studies.
- Maintain a high level of productivity in the laboratory setting to meet the timelines for in vitro and in vivo studies.
Requirements
- Hands-on experience in oligonucleotide synthesis using automated oligo synthesizers, Client nucleic acid chemistry, oligonucleotide purification and characterization using HPLC and mass spectrometry.
- A BS/MS in Organic Chemistry or related discipline.
- Theoretical and practical knowledge of oligonucleotide therapeutics, modification chemistries, sequence selection, and mechanism of action.
- Relevant experience in oligonucleotide therapeutics, large molecule drug discovery, oligonucleotide delivery or bio-conjugation is desirable.
